    Product description

    Synopsis
    Draven de Montague, Earl of Ravenswood, brings his enemy's daughter to live with him for a year, in order to try to bring about some kind of reconciliation. He soon finds himself falling for the beautiful, spirited Emily Hugh, even though he has promised himself not to become entangled with this bold and witty young girl.

    A Dream of Desire Awakened . . .

    Beautiful Lady Emily dreams of the rapture of love and the joys of marriage. The youngest daughter of an English lord at war, she is shaken by the arrival of a mysterious stranger to her father's castle. Could this breathtaking man be Emily's yearned-for lover? Indeed, Draven de Montague, Earl of Ravenswood, has come for Emily . . . but romance has nothing to do with it.

    In the Tender Embrace of an Enemy . . .

    Draven would never have entered the home of his most hated adversary had not the King himself ordered him to take in his foe's daughter for a year to forge bonds of peace between their two feuding houses. Worse still, here is a lass whose exquisite loveliness could tempt Draven to betray his sworn vow never to let anther close to his heart. Emily knows the searing heat of her passion could burn down the defenses of this proud warrior. But will the surrender of the sweet nectar of his lips and his bold, sensuous caress ignite a blaze so hot it consumes them both?

    Loved it a keeper for me......(:D)

    Created: 31/01/06
    I LOVE kinley Macgregor for these wonderful fun, sexy great books worth the read. I thought it was well written great humor from simon the heroe's brother and the other characters and i also thought the ending was perfect. Really and truly a romantic novel..Also this is the book to read to start off the series of the BROTHER HOOD OF THE SWORDS & THE MACALLISTERS..
